    25-82525. GNIS feature ID. 0618262. Website. www.yarmouth.ma.us. Yarmouth (/ ˈjɑːrməθ / YAR-məth) is a town in Barnstable County, Massachusetts, United States, on Cape Cod. The population was 25,023 at the 2020 census. The town is made up of three major villages: South Yarmouth, West Yarmouth, and Yarmouth Port.

    South Yarmouth is located in the southeastern quarter of the town of Yarmouth at 41°40′4″N 70°11′59″W (41.667908, -70.199774). [4] It is bordered by the CDP of West Yarmouth to the west and West Dennis to the east. U.S. Route 6, the Mid-Cape Highway, is to the north, beyond which is the CDP of Yarmouth Port.

    November 24, 1987. The Northside Historic District encompasses two of the earliest significant settlement areas of Yarmouth, Massachusetts. Stretching along Massachusetts Route 6A from the Barnstable line in the west to White Brook in the east, the district includes almost 300 buildings on 50 acres (20 ha).
